Log:
Setting breakpoints with name mask eFunctionNameTypeBase was broken for straight C names by 220432. Get
that working again.

+ // Extract C++ context and identifier from a string using heuristic matching (as opposed to
+ // CPPLanguageRuntime::MethodName which has to have a fully qualified C++ name with parens and arguments.
+ // If the name is a lone C identifier (e.g. C) or a qualified C identifier (e.g. A::B::C) it will return true,
+ // and identifier will be the identifier (C and C respectively) and the context will be "" and "A::B::" respectively.
+ // If the name fails the heuristic matching for a qualified or unqualified C/C++ identifier, then it will return false
+ // and identifier and context will be unchanged.
